West Mud Lake
West Mud Lake is in Chautauqua County, Southern Tier, New York. West Mud Lake is situated nearby to the hamlet Black Corners, as well as near the village Arkwright.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Arkwright
Village
Arkwright is a town in Chautauqua County, New York, United States. As of the 2020 census, the town population was 1,000. The town is named after Richard Arkwright, the inventor of a spinning device. Arkwright is situated 3 miles west of West Mud Lake.

Forestville is a hamlet in Chautauqua County, New York, United States. The population was 697 at the 2010 census. The hamlet is within the town of Hanover and in the northeast part of the county. It was an incorporated village from 1848 to 2016. Forestville is situated 4½ miles north of West Mud Lake.
